Facilities Ticket — Cleaning Crew Access, Brindle Annex

For new starters handling evening lock-up: the Sorano Cleaning crew arrives nightly at 21:30 via the annex side door. Check their rota sheet, note arrival in the log, and ensure the storeroom is relocked afterward. To let them through the side door, enter the access code below.

badge for yaweg-hafog: bdg-GX-6

## Runbook: Moving your plugin build onto Kilnforge

We're shifting all Oakenreel plugin builds to the Kilnforge hermetic build system, which means no more reaching out to the network mid-build — every dependency has to be pinned and mirrored ahead of time. The good news: builds become reproducible and a lot faster on cache hits. Vendor your toolchain manifest, run the fetch step once, then build offline. Before your first hermetic build, make sure your workspace carries the following configuration values.

service settings:
wenix:
  pin: 0857
  metrics_host: metrics.wenix.lumiclabs.internal
  tenant: ulavan
  seal: seal_db298014

## Ticket: Config drift on retention sweeper (prod-east)

The Gleanwick data-retention sweeper in prod-east has drifted from the declared baseline. Sweep intervals and the dry-run flag no longer match what the manifest repository specifies, likely from a manual hotfix applied during last month's incident that was never backported. Until drift is reconciled, deletions in that region may lag policy by several days. Please compare the running state against the repo and restore parity. The intended baseline values are these.

settings of fafog-haduf:
ZORIX_PIN=4648
ZORIX_METRICS_HOST=metrics.zorix.paliqsys.corp
ZORIX_LOG_LEVEL=info
ZORIX_TENANT=druix

**Ticket: Signature check failed on cachefix-1.7.3**

The hotfix build addressing the stale-cache bug (see postmortem PM-Larkspur) fails signature verification in the Ostgate pipeline. Root cause: the artifact was signed with the retired pre-rotation key, which the verifier no longer trusts. Rebuild is queued; postmortem remediation items are unaffected. Re-sign the artifact using the current deploy key below.

release key, fajof-fawef: bky19_jNcDy5ia68rvEn25WjQ